Adler Mannheim celebrate main round victory in the CHL

The Adler Mannheim have secured the main round victory in the Champions Hockey League. The second-placed team in the German Ice Hockey League (DEL) beat HC Kosice from Slovakia 4-1 (0-1, 2-0, 2-0) at the end of the group phase on Wednesday and will now face the Swiss from in the round of 16 SC Rapperswil-Jona Lakers, supposedly the easiest opponent.

David Wolf (28th), Kris Bennett (37th), Tyler Gaudet (45th) and national player Daniel Fischbuch (57th) scored Mannheim’s goals after the hosts had taken the lead through Joona Jaaskelainen (19th). According to the new mode, the Eagles, who won five of their six games, will be the first in the round of 16 to meet the 16th in the preliminary round.

The German champions Red Bull Munich and ERC Ingolstadt are also in the round of 16. Ingolstadt will face the Swedish champions Växjö Lakers in 15th place. Munich’s opponent has not yet been determined. The round of 16 first legs will take place on November 14th and 15th.
